12110329
0xe83ef39ca06b52074868993b76228f5ae6e06b249c2497f92e4c0844d491c47c
Transactions112
Height12110329
Confirmations8029790
Timestamp1183 days 15 hours ago
Size (bytes)33483
Version
Merkle Root
Nonce0xebba03b53dc7b689
Bits
Difficulty0x152d6234d29d14

Transactions

ERC20 Token Transfers
mined 1183 days 15 hours ago
Failed
0xa5d754d1